How To Reach Your Target Audience on Social Media
Find Your Target Market
If you haven’t already defined buyer personas for your business, start with the demographics of your customers. Some details you’ll want to research are: gender, location, age, income bracket, and relationship status. You can use Google Analytics, surveys, and customer service interactions to find this information. Then move on to what makes your customers tick. What are their interests, professions, lifestyles, and political or religious views? It is best to narrow down as much as you can.

Analyze and Modify
Because social media changes so quickly, you don’t want to adopt a “set it and forget it” attitude. Use the analytics tools specific to each platform to see how your posts are performing and adjust as needed. We recommend doing this on a weekly basis at first, and then backing off to a bi-weekly or monthly check-in.
